WebAt the same dose, ex vivo platelet aggregation induced by ADP, collagen, and AA was inhibited by l-NBP and the antithrombotic effects of the compound were also observed. Thus, NBP exerts oral anti-platelet and anti-thrombotic efficacy without perturbing systemic hemostasis in rats. l-NBP is more potent than d- and dl-NBP as antiplatelet agent. Webion. l-NBP was the most potent among l-, d-, and dl-NBP. At higher concentration the effect of dl-NBP on platelet aggregation was greater than that of l- or d-NBP alone. The ex vivo antiaggregatory activity of l-NBP 100mg/kg declined gradually after 2 hours, but a considerable antiplatelet activity was still observed 4h after l-NBP administration. Objectives: Summarize the mechanisms of … dog face kaomojiWebJul 22, 2024 · Pimpinellin is a coumarin-like compound extracted from the root of Toddalia asiatica. Its effects on platelet function has not been investigated. This study found that pimpinellin pretreatment effectively inhibited collagen-induced platelet aggregation, but did not alter ADP- and thrombin-induced aggregation.
